Foggy Notions is proud to present a unique and unforgettable evening with four fabulous musical personalities; Mislaid is a collaboration between two renowned singer-songwriters and two innovative Irish traditional musicians.

The four artists will take up residence at the Tyrone Guthrie Centre, Co. Monaghan, from 20-27th October, during which time they will work on their collaborative show, which is touring from 27 Oct – 1st Nov at select venues around the country.

Grammy-nominated Glaswegian singer Norman Blake is best known as part of the legendary Scottish guitar band Teenage Fanclub. Welsh songwriter Euros Childs found fame as front-man for the amazing psychedelic group Gorky’s Zygotic Mynci.

Both Blake and Childs have been working on a new duo album Jonny due out in 2010.

Blake, Childs and Kennedy performed together as part of the 2009 Celtic Connections International Festival. Dublin fiddler Caoimhín Ó Raghallaigh was invited onboard by the Co. Louth flautist and singer Nuala Kennedy (ex Harem Scarem).

Kennedy’s commission Astar:Journey for Celtic Connections International Festival was heralded as “breathtaking” and a “triumph” by the national press. It featured an international line-up of musicians from Scotland, Canada and the States, including Will Oldham.
